**Q: What caused the Lanternfell stale-cache incident?**

A: The invalidation queue in Driftwell silently dropped messages after a schema change, so reviewers saw week-old diffs. The fix adds versioned cache keys and an alert on queue lag. Reviewers verifying the patch need the audit vault; open it with the passphrase that follows.

unlock words, fadup-fawef: druath-ulaael

Ticket #4821 — Splitgate assignment service vault locked

Plugin authors integrating with the Splitgate A/B assignment API are reporting that the credentials vault has auto-locked after three failed unseal attempts. This blocks fetching experiment bucket assignments in staging, so plugin test suites fail at the handshake step. Variant allocation itself is unaffected in production. We've confirmed the vault image is intact and only needs re-unsealing. Per the Splitgate escrow policy, unsealing requires the recovery passphrase, which is:

unlock words, fafop-hawep: briwyn-oliix-sorox

CI Troubleshooting — Ratewell Tax Cache

Support team: if customers report outdated tax rates, first check whether the nightly cache-warm job on the Ostbridge cluster completed. A failed warm leaves the previous day's table active, which is expected behavior, not corruption. Before escalating to engineering, capture the job status alongside the trace token printed below.

pipeline stamp: htk4_ae36